En esta breve publicación de blog, compartiré cómo puedes configurar tu espacio de desarrollo de SAP Business Application Studio para ejecutar cuadernos Jupyter
📓
.
Personalmente disfruto trabajando con cuadernos Jupyter. Es una herramienta rápida y sencilla que resulta muy útil al explorar datos o como un espacio de pruebas para probar algo de código en Python.
Antes de poder ejecutar cuadernos Jupyter en SAP Business Application Studio, necesitamos instalar
pip
. pip es el instalador de paquetes para Python y lo utilizaremos para instalar algunos paquetes disponibles públicamente. SAP Business Application Studio requiere pip para poder instalar
ipykernel
, que es necesario para ejecutar el cuaderno dentro del entorno.
En el video anterior, demuestro todos los pasos mencionados a continuación para ejecutar cuadernos Jupyter
🐍
dentro de SAP Business Application Studio.
Pasos mostrados en el video:
Abrir la terminal (F1).
Descargar pip, instalarlo, agregar su ubicación al PATH, y luego proceder a instalar los paquetes de Python
hana-ml
y
hdbcli
que se importarán más tarde en el cuaderno.
# Descargar el script get-pip, instalarlo, agregar la ubicación de instalación a tu PATH
$ curl https://bootstrap.pypa.io/get-pip.py > get-pip.py && python3 get-pip.py && echo "export PATH=/home/user/.local/bin:$PATH">>.bashrc && source ~/.bashrc
# Instalar paquetes de Python relacionados con hana
$ pip install hdbcli hana-ml shapely
Instalar las extensiones
python
y
Jupyter
que son muy útiles al usar cuadernos Jupyter.
Crear un cuaderno y ejecutar algo de código Python simple para instalar y ejecutar
ipykernel
. Este paquete proporciona el kernel IPython para Jupyter.
x=1+2print(x)
Importar los paquetes relacionados con hana previamente instalados.
from hana_ml import dataframe
from hdbcli import dbapi
Quitar espacios en una consulta SQL
Quitar espacios en una consulta SQL
Cuando trabajamos con consultas SQL, a menudo nos encontramos con la necesidad de limpiar o mani...
Transacciones MIGO y MIRO en SAP MM
Transacciones MIGO y MIRO en SAP MM
1. ¿Qué es la transacción MIGO?
La transacción MIGO (Entrada de Mercancías) se utiliza para registrar las mercancías que...
He creado este documento de instrucciones en wiki el año pasado. Dado que wiki aún no se ha integrado en SCN y aparte de usar Google, no puedo encontrar fácilmente este artículo. Por lo tant...
Pasos para abrir y cerrar período - MM FI CO
Muchos de nosotros luchamos con los cambios de períodos en nuestros entornos DEV y QA, aquí tienes una referencia rápida para abrir y...